Vehicle buyers have been flocking to dealers to look at the new Ford Edge in Barrington. The crossover handles like a sedan but gives features similar to those found in a full size SUV. The Ford Edge has been at the sharp end from the beginning of this trend, having introduced the Edge back in 2007. Ford did not try to squeeze more seating capacity into the Edge; they were content to offer buyers a very secure vehicle that was easy to drive and was packed with features. Although it is ten years later, nothing has changed conceptually but the new models have come a long way with multiple new engine choices an improved ride.

The Ford Edge today:

Despite the weight and the height of the Ford Edge in Barrington, it rides and handles like a sedan. The current Edge has a very up-market interior with numerous features not found in competitive vehicles. A fully loaded Edge is well into the luxury vehicle class. Rather than provide three rows of seats which would give the driver and passengers very cramped quarters, Ford decided long ago to offer plenty of room in the backseat, an ideal vehicle for a modern family.

Depending on your needs and your budget, the Ford Edge in Barrington is available in four different trims. The SE; the base model has all the basics, nothing is left off. It has remote locking, air conditioning and a convenient 60/40 split rear seat allowing for a passenger even though you’re carrying a long load. As the trims move up, so does the equipment. By the time you are up to the Titanium edge you can expect full leather upholstery, large touchscreen, 12 speaker sound system and more.

There is no doubt that the new Ford Edge in Barrington offers a great deal of car for the money.
